Kalshi

Resolution is based on the official announcement of the Big Brother Season 28 winner during the finale or via official channels immediately following. The winner must be officially declared by the show; if no winner is announced, all markets resolve to No. In the event of multiple joint winners, each resolves to Yes with payouts split equally. A houseguest who declines the prize still counts as a winner unless acceptance was an explicit condition of victory. Disqualifications or withdrawals occurring before the finale result in No resolution. Later title stripping or revocation does not affect the original resolution—only the announcement made at the finale governs. Secondary awards such as fan favorite do not qualify as the main winner. For team or couples competitions, being part of the winning unit counts as winning.

Prediction market odds often diverge from traditional analyst forecasts because they incorporate real-money incentives and live trader activity rather than editorial opinion alone. While analysts may rely on historical Big Brother patterns and contestant backgrounds, this market aggregates the views of many participants constantly reassessing odds based on gameplay, alliances, and public voting trends. Markets tend to react faster to dramatic twists or eliminations, sometimes pricing in outcomes before mainstream media consensus catches up, making them a complementary data source for understanding contestant viability.

On Kalshi, this market is priced through an order-book mechanism where traders buy and sell shares representing each potential winner. On Kalshi, prices reflect that venue's order book, liquidity, and how traders price the outcome right now. Prices reflect the collective willingness of participants to bet on a given houseguest, with higher prices indicating stronger perceived chances of victory. As new information emerges—eliminations, competition results, or shifts in viewer sentiment—traders adjust their positions, and prices move to reflect updated probabilities in real time.
